Symptom: Quillbase sessions expire mid-request despite valid refresh calls. Cause: the refresh worker races the revocation sweep, invalidating tokens issued in the last 30 seconds. Fix: restart the token-mint pod, then replay failed refreshes via /admin/refresh-replay. Verify with two consecutive 200s. The replay endpoint requires elevated auth; use the bearer token below.

portal login ticket: eyJhbGciOiJIUzI1NiIsInR5cCI6IkpXVCJ9.eyJzdWIiOiIMjvRAf3PEFIn0.nuv9gjixLtnr

To the sales leads: as I hand responsibilities to Director Malveen Okarro, please note the Brightquill support outsourcing plan remains on track. Vendor shortlisting with Tessaline Services in Port Averin closes next month. Keep client messaging cautious: confirm continuity of service levels, avoid committing to pricing changes, and route escalations through Malveen's office. Full diligence files are in the shared register. The following note is strictly confidential and must not leave this group.

internal memo for kaduf-baduf: Only 35 of the 378 pilot accounts renewed Holir, so a churn review is set for June 11. Eliielax Group is in early talks to buy Silaelix Group for about $142.1 million.

Subject: Westlake Reach Expansion — Status

Team: Expansion into the Westlake Reach region is approved. Lease signed on the Tarnholt site; fit-out starts next month. Incoming director owns go-to-market from day one — distributor talks with Ferrow & Sons are mid-stage, pricing undecided. Headcount: six approved, recruitment underway. Regulatory filings clear in roughly five weeks. No external comms until launch date is fixed. Full context for the regional play is in the confidential note below.

board note of kageg-bahof: The renewal with Holwynax Holdings closes at $2 million a year, 5 percent below the last contract. Project Ulaath slips by two quarters because of the supplier delay.